黑狐家游戏

深入解析Minio分布式集群搭建,高效存储解决方案实践,分布式集群安装

欧气 0 0

本文目录导读:

  1. Minio分布式集群概述
  2. Minio分布式集群搭建步骤

随着大数据时代的到来,企业对于数据存储的需求日益增长,Minio作为一个开源的对象存储服务,凭借其高性能、可扩展性和高可靠性等特点,成为了许多企业存储解决方案的首选,本文将详细介绍Minio分布式集群的搭建过程,帮助您快速掌握高效存储解决方案的实践方法。

Minio分布式集群概述

Minio分布式集群是由多个Minio节点组成的存储系统,通过数据分片和复制机制,实现数据的冗余存储和负载均衡,在Minio分布式集群中,每个节点负责存储一部分数据,节点之间通过Paxos算法保证数据的一致性。

深入解析Minio分布式集群搭建,高效存储解决方案实践,分布式集群安装

图片来源于网络,如有侵权联系删除

Minio分布式集群搭建步骤

1、准备Minio节点

需要准备多个Minio节点,这些节点可以是物理机、虚拟机或云服务器,确保每个节点具备以下条件:

(1)操作系统:推荐使用CentOS 7、Ubuntu 18.04等稳定版本。

(2)网络:确保节点之间可以相互通信。

(3)存储空间:每个节点至少分配1TB存储空间。

2、安装Minio

在所有节点上执行以下命令安装Minio:

sudo yum install -y minio

3、配置Minio

编辑/etc/minio/minio.conf文件,配置以下参数:

深入解析Minio分布式集群搭建,高效存储解决方案实践,分布式集群安装

图片来源于网络,如有侵权联系删除

[server]
address = 192.168.1.100:9000
region = us-east-1
datacenter = 1

address为节点IP地址和端口号,region为地域名称,datacenter为数据中心名称。

4、创建Minio集群

在第一个节点上执行以下命令创建Minio集群:

sudo minio server /data/minio --console-address localhost:9000 --region us-east-1 --datacenter 1

5、添加节点

在其余节点上执行以下命令添加到Minio集群:

sudo minio server /data/minio --console-address localhost:9000 --region us-east-1 --datacenter 1 --force-everything --address 192.168.1.101:9000

192.168.1.101为第二个节点的IP地址。

6、验证集群

在任意节点上执行以下命令验证Minio集群状态:

sudo minio cluster info

输出结果应显示所有节点的IP地址和端口号。

深入解析Minio分布式集群搭建,高效存储解决方案实践,分布式集群安装

图片来源于网络,如有侵权联系删除

通过以上步骤,您已经成功搭建了一个Minio分布式集群,Minio分布式集群具备以下优势:

1、高性能:通过数据分片和负载均衡,实现高效的数据读写。

2、可扩展性:根据需求动态增加节点,提升存储容量和性能。

3、高可靠性:通过数据冗余和Paxos算法保证数据一致性。

4、易用性:提供简单的API和命令行工具,方便用户进行操作。

Minio分布式集群是一个高效、可靠的存储解决方案,适合各种规模的企业,希望本文能帮助您快速搭建Minio分布式集群,实现高效存储。

标签: #minio分布式集群搭建

黑狐家游戏
  • 评论列表

留言评论